700IE屏用的是WINCCFLEXIBLE2008SP4软件,里面想做一个能设定断开延时时间的变量,格式要是99.9S这样的,这样的话,画面上数据格式只能选REAL,变量用VD的,到200PLC里面用TOF功能块的适合,形参PT只能接受VD类型的,我要用基数为100MS的功能块T37,若画面上用VD1,PT上用VW1,则VW1取的值应该是VD1的10倍,这个到程序里面似乎没有办法转换啊,画面上也没法写脚本,求解,用其他上位软件或PLC的时候还没遇到过这种问题。。。
最佳答案
实数转整数这个可以在PLC中转啊
VD1=1.1S 、 VD1*10.0=VD5 、将VD5转成整数 、放入VW10 、 PT输入VW10 就行了吧
没脚本PLC就负责多点吧。
提问者对于答案的评价:
是这么做的,但是是用VW11给PT
专家置评
已阅,最佳答案正确。
原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c217763.html